The Department’s office reopening will be a gradual and phased return to a safe level of in …Your monthly benefit is split into two payments. DTA will issue your payments on specific dates each month based on the last digit of your Social Security Number. See the chart below. For example, if your Social Security Number ends in 5, you will get your TAFDC on the 8th and 23rd of each month. If your total out-of-pocket health care costs are over $35 and up to $190, you can call DTA to directly verify those expenses over the phone. You can also tell DTA by sending a written note on DTA Connect. No further documentation needed. You will need to provide documentary proof of all your health care costs if they total over $190. How does DTA count income for SNAP? DTA counts income and expenses using a monthly average calculation of 4 and 1/3 weeks for each month. For example, if your gross earnings are $500 per week, we would calculate your monthly earnings this way: $500 x 4.333 = $2,166.50 per month. According to its website, …For SNAP, you must report the following changes within 10 days of the change: Change in amount of income your household has, if the change is more than $125 a month. Change in where the income comes from (the income source) – if the amount of income you have also changes.
